Telangana: RIMS Adilabad to recruit 16 super specialty doctors
Adilabad: To ensure the provision of quality medical services, the Rajiv Gandhi Institute of Medical Sciences (RIMS) in Adilabad has decided to recruit 16 super-specialty doctors at the institute and the super-speciality hospital.
The institute director Dr Jaisingh Rathod made the announcement where he said the state government would appoint 16 doctors in order to boost the medical services at the institute.
He said that the hospital has won the trust of the people in the region, according to a media report in Telangana Today.

With the coming of the medical institute and super specialty hospital in Adilabad, people have reportedly stopped going to neighbouring cities for better healthcare services, he said.
Rajiv Gandhi Institute of Medical Sciences, Adilabad or RIMS Adilabad is a medical institute affiliated with Kaloji Narayana Rao University of Health Sciences. It was established in the Adilabad region of Telangana in 2008. A number of speciality services including General Medicine, General Surgery, OBGY, Pediatrics, Orthopedics, Skin & STD, TB & CD, Anesthesia, Lab services in Pathology, Microbiology & Biochemistry, Radiology, Psychology, ENT, Ophthalmology, Dentistry, Casualty, etc are provided at the RIMS hospital.
